/****************************************************************************** * Compilation: javac-introcs BouncingBall.java * Execution: java-introcs BouncingBall * Dependencies: StdDraw.java * * Implementation of a 2-d bouncing ball in the box from (-1, -1) to (1, 1). * * % java BouncingBall * ******************************************************************************/ public class BouncingBall { public static void main(String[] args) { // set the scale of the coordinate system StdDraw.setXscale(-1.0, 1.0); StdDraw.setYscale(-1.0, 1.0); StdDraw.enableDoubleBuffering(); // initial values double rx = 0.480, ry = 0.860; // position double vx = 0.015, vy = 0.023; // velocity double radius = 0.05; // radius // main animation loop while (true) { // bounce off wall according to law of elastic collision if (Math.abs(rx + vx) > 1.0 - radius) vx = -vx; if (Math.abs(ry + vy) > 1.0 - radius) vy = -vy; // update position rx = rx + vx; ry = ry + vy; // clear the background StdDraw.clear(StdDraw.LIGHT_GRAY); // draw ball on the screen StdDraw.setPenColor(StdDraw.BLACK); StdDraw.filledCircle(rx, ry, radius); // copy offscreen buffer to onscreen StdDraw.show(); // pause for 20 ms StdDraw.pause(20); } } }
